Faces of America

Motion Graphics and Photo Retouching

Over 150 unique segments created for this documentary mini-series for PBS, largely consisting of photographic and image moves. Large amount of photo retouching and color correction performed. Multiplane 3D perspective effect created on 2D images to give effect of moving through space. Faces of America airs in February 2010 on PBS.

Art Appreciation wins!

Our short film airs on Reel 13 on PBS

Recently, we entered our short animated film Art Appreciation into WNET Channel 13’s Reel13 shorts competition. Viewers were given the chance to vote online for their favorite., We were thrilled when ours won and broadcast on WNET as well as online. Art Appreciation is a humorous 3D computer animated short created and directed by Joe Herman.

Nozin Nasal Sanitizer

Design and Digital Illustration

Our friends at Global Life Technologies hired us to come up with a look for their new product Nozin Nasal Sanitizer. We took a whimsical approach and created some characters (left) which they used for their package design and their advertising campaign. We also created 3D renders of the bottle for the box as well as 3D renders of the product and displays for marketing and presentation purposes.

Electric Avenue

Storyboards and Pre-visualization

Electric Avenue is a British noir feature film produced in the UK. Besides the storyboards for the movie, we also created pre-visualization drawings and production designs. A series of storyboard panels were created as requested by the director during pre-production (a small sample of which are shown on the left). All artwork was digitally painted in Photoshop.
